Drupal 7 e E-Commerce



Drupal 7 tornou-se emblemática a versão da plataforma de gerenciamento de conteúdo. No ano passado eu estava montando um par de webstores com Drupal 6 e e-commerce módulos (addons) por isso chamados coletivamente Ubercart. Ubercart foi um pouco complexo, mas as coisas funcionavam. Para as arestas houve outros módulos para suavizar as bordas.

Recentemente eu tenho trabalhado com uma instalação do Drupal 7 e construir um site de comércio eletrônico. Ubercart está disponível em um estado de teste para Drupal 7, mas muitos dos desenvolvedores deixaram a favor de um módulo chamado Commerce. Que também está em um estado de teste. O que se segue é um breve resumo das minhas provações e tribulações na construção de um site de comércio eletrônico com Drupal 7.

Primeiro, deixe-me dizer que o Drupal 7 apresenta uma muito mais limpo, mais fácil se aproximar de interface do Drupal 6. As opções são mais propensos a precisar a frente com mais freqüência são apresentados e centro (adicionar conteúdo / encontrar o conteúdo). Além disso, a navegação por padrão é dado a você na forma de uma barra de cabeçalho, se você estiver conectado ao site. Eu sinto que a curva de aprendizado em encontrar as coisas em Drupal 7 não é tão íngreme como o foi para drupal 6.

Eu também achei os meios para a instalação de novos temas e módulos melhorou muito, mas ainda deixam muito a desejar. Eu apenas descobri drush que é uma ferramenta de linha de comando para gerenciar uma instalação do Drupal que pode fazer a adição de temas e módulos trivialmente rápidas e fáceis. (Mas isso é alimento para outra história.)

Assim, Comecei minhas aventuras com drupal 7 e trabalhando em um carrinho de compras com Ubercart. Em algum lugar ao longo do caminho eu tive alguns problemas sérios com dependências de módulo e teve de soprar o banco de dados e começar de novo. Havia módulos que jogou fora os erros de php. Infelizmente, o módulo que causou os erros era um módulo de publicidade que não estava relacionado para Ubercart. Eu desativei os módulos e os erros ainda estavam lá, era, em resumo, uma bagunça.

Então eu comecei a longo e cuidadosamente trabalhado meu caminho através de encontrar os módulos necessários. Eu tinha coisas muito bom olhar e depois foi para tentar resolver algumas arestas com o carrinho. Tenho a intenção de oferecer o transporte plana e por isso o “clique para calcular o transporte” botão parecia estranho. Também, Eu preferia quando um item está fora de estoque para o “adicionar ao carrinho” botão para não estar disponível para clicar. Ambos os problemas foram resolvidos por módulos addon para Ubercart. Módulos que, infelizmente não ter sido lançado em uma versão compatível com drupal 7.

Minhas escolhas foram para rever o código-fonte-me a tentar torná-los compatíveis, contratar alguém para fazê-lo, ou procurar uma outra solução. Nesse ponto, eu tinha visto que a maior parte do interesse o desenvolvimento da ligação havia mudado de Ubercart para um novo módulo chamado comércio. So…. Eu pensei que poderia ser o caminho de menor resistêncAssim. So, Eu desativado Ubercart e instalado comércio.

Ao fazê-lo, descobri que houve algumas características que simplesmente não funcionam. Porquê? Módulo dependências. Existem algumas características que exigem a versão atual de desenvolvimento dos diversos módulos. Assim, Eu atualizar a esses módulos. Infelizmente a atualização para os módulos dev não é suficiente que eu precisava para instalar somente a partir do primeiro ramo de desenvolvimento. Argh…. nuke o banco de dados e começar tudo de novo era a minha única solução.

Assim, Eu já reconstruiu o site novamente com muito cuidado puxando nas versões de desenvolvimento necessárias dos pré-requisitos e, em seguida, instalar o próprio comércio e alguns dos módulos que o companheiro. Agora que eu tenho isso corretamente instalado e funcionando eu tenho um grande apreço por ele. parece mais magro do que Ubercart e menos complexo. (Não é uma coisa ruim.) Eu estou gostando da simplicidade.

Chegar a esta simplicidade tem sido uma tarefa frustrante embora. Estou ansioso para os módulos de estabilização e de não necessitar instalação cuidadosa tais. Quanto drupal – Espero para ver a versão 7 tornam-se mais robusto para lidar com instalação e remoção de módulos. Os problemas que se deparou parecia ter a ver com tabelas que não são corretamente criados em reinstalar. Embora neste momento eu poderia estar enganado na minha declaração do problema. Eu me lembro que havia um bug arquivado em drupal sobre o problema e era um problema citado pelos criadores de comércio como algo que precisa ser corrigido antes que você poderia atualizar para a versão dev dos módulos necessários e esperar que as coisas funcionam.

Eu acho que drupal 7 tem um futuro brilhante. Parece ser uma grande melhoria sobre a versão 6. Comércio parece ser uma grande melhoria sobre a estrutura das Ubercart bem. Eu acho que dentro de 6 meses a um ano, será a pilha para open source lojas carrinho de compras. Eu que esperar sobre as atualizações de sites drupal 6/ubercart embora por algum tempo. Talvez um simples drupal 6 site com carrinho de compras não seria uma atualização segura, mas será interessante ver o quão rapidamente o comércio / drupal 7 solução amadurece.

Posts Relacionados

Blog Traffic Exchange Posts Relacionados
  • Vinho ajuda Não, não vermelho ou branco. Eu estou falando do Vinho (Wine não é um emulador) , que permite que aplicações Windows rodem no Linux. Um dos sites que eu encontrei que tem algumas ótimas dicas sobre vinho é Corner Franks. Durante vários anos, este site tem sido uma boa fonte de ......
  • A viagem começa segunda ... Mandriva 2006 melhorar 2 - Parte 10 Eu acho que é hora de embrulhar as coisas. O KDE início opção nova sessão está de volta após as mudanças que eu mencionei para o / etc / kde / kdm / kdmrc arquivo que eu mencionei em um post anterior. Não há questões pendentes da atualização. (Eu preciso ajustar os tamanhos de fonte para baixo um pouco, mas ......
  • Google Analytics sob o microscópio Eu passei algum tempo esta noite olhando para o Google Analytics. (Agora os dados estão sendo coletados.) E eu tenho que dizer que estou impressionado com o alcance do que eu estou vendo. Primeiro, desde ontem à noite, mais estatísticas foram coletadas, parece haver alguma falta de hoje ainda (talvez ~ 12 ......
Blog Traffic Exchange Sites Relacionados
  • Crescer o seu negócio com um blog da empresa Se você está procurando uma maneira de crescer o seu negócio, mas você não tem um monte de recursos disponíveis à sua disposição, um blog corporativo é um dos meios mais fáceis de realizar este objetivo. Os custos de setup são mínimos e com o direito de gestão, você pode facilmente ......
  • Retorno Visitantes dá-lhe posição de destaque nos motores de busca Hoje o que todo mundo assume que atraindo mais e mais visitantes é a maneira mais fácil de aumentar o tráfego. De alguma forma é verdade, mas um site será verdadeiramente popular se faz com que os novos visitantes para voltar novamente e novamente. É muito mais fácil levar as pessoas a visitar o seu ......
  • The website trend that could save you money It used to be the case, before comparison sites like moneysupermarket.com  came along, that the process of shopping around for insurance was a laborious task that involved a lot of phone calls and hours of your time. This was because consumers had to spend time repeating their details in full......
PDF24    Enviar artigo como PDF   

Posts similares


Veja o que aconteceu neste dia na história de qualquer BBC Wikipedia
Pesquisar:
Palavras-chave:
Amazon Logo

Os comentários estão fechados.


Mude para o nosso site móvel